GRiT Ambassador Program
The NICA GRiT Ambassador Program aims to engage female student-athletes in spreading the word about the GRiT Program within NICA leagues. The GRiT Ambassador will be a student-athlete representative for the GRiT Program, help raise awareness of the effort to get #moregirlsonbikes and, most importantly, be a local advocate and voice for what our female student-athletes want out of the GRiT Program. GRiT Ambassadors play a key role in recruiting and retaining more girls in NICA programs at the state level.
